Back to the basket, Vucevic can't see the rim, but that doesn't mean he can't score. The All-Star center can get buckets with a quick spin shot or a polished fadeaway. In 2020-21, he recorded 314 points out of post-up looks, third most in the league behind Joel Embiid and Nikola Jokic.
